Tool Integrations

Best Way To Create Popups in Drupal

Drupal is a fantastic CMS, and with its recent updates, it's only getting better. However, I know creating marketing popups in Drupal can sometimes feel clunky.

That's why I'm excited to show you How To Create Popup in Drupal:

Step 1: Install the Poper Module in Drupal

First things first, you'll need to install the Poper module directly into your Drupal installation.

Install Drupal Plugin

Think of this as laying the foundation for Poper to work seamlessly with your Drupal site. You can find the module at https://www.drupal.org/project/poper.

Follow the instructions on that page to get it installed correctly. In most Drupal setups, you can use the command composer require 'drupal/poper:^1.0@alpha' in your terminal.

Step 2: Connect Your Poper Account to Drupal

After the module is installed, you'll need to connect it to your Poper account. This is how Drupal knows which Poper account to pull your popups from.

Head over to Poper and sign up (if you haven't already). Once you're in, grab your Account Email from your account settings.

Using Email in Drupal Plugin

Then, in your Drupal admin panel, go to "Modules > Poper > Configure" and paste your Account Email into the designated field. Saving the Account Email syncs the two systems.

Step 3: Time to Build Your First Popup

Create a new Popup in Poper

With the connection established, it's time for the fun part: creating your popup! This happens entirely within the Poper platform, so head back to your Poper dashboard.

Step 4: Choose a Template and Launch Your Campaign

Customize the Popup

In Poper, click the button to create a new popup. You'll see a library of templates designed for different purposes, such as growing your email list or promoting a sale.

Browse through the options and pick one that aligns with your goal. I recommend starting with a simple template to get a feel for the editor. Once you’re happy with your design, publish your campaign.

Step 5: Test Your Popups in Drupal

Now that you've created and published your popup, it's time to see it live on your Drupal site. Open your website in a new browser window (or an incognito window to avoid caching issues).

Browse to a page where you expect the popup to appear based on the rules you set in Poper. If you don't see it right away, double-check that the campaign is active in Poper and that your Account Email is correctly entered in Drupal. Refreshing the cache might also help. Here's a dedicated guide to Refresh the cache in Drupal.

How to Create Popups in Drupal Different Versions (Complete Guide)

Drupal is a fantastic CMS, and with its recent updates, it's only getting better. However, I know creating marketing popups in Drupal can sometimes feel clunky. That's why I'm excited to show you how to easily create popups in Drupal with Poper.

1. How to Create a Popup in Drupal 8

If you’re still using Drupal 8, here’s how to set up a popup:

  • Install the Poper Module:

    • Run: composer require 'drupal/poper:^1.0@alpha'
    • Enable it via the Drupal admin panel.

  • Run: composer require 'drupal/poper:^1.0@alpha'

  • Enable it via the Drupal admin panel.

  • Connect Your Poper Account to Drupal.

  • Build Your First Popup in the Poper Dashboard.

  • Choose a Template, set display conditions, and publish.

  • Test your popup in Drupal 8 by refreshing the cache.

2. How to Create a Popup in Drupal 9

Drupal 9 introduced performance improvements and better third-party integration. Here's how to set up popups in Drupal 9:

  • Follow the same steps as in Drupal 8.

  • Ensure compatibility by running: composer require 'drupal/poper:^2.0@stable'

  • Drupal 9 has improved JavaScript API handling, making Poper-based popups more efficient.

3. How to Create a Popup in Drupal 10

Drupal 10 further streamlined frontend performance and dropped outdated dependencies. Follow these steps to create a popup in Drupal 10:

  • Install the latest Poper Module version: composer require 'drupal/poper:^3.0@stable'

  • Use modern JS frameworks (jQuery is deprecated).

  • Connect Poper to Drupal 10 and design your popup.

  • Mobile optimization: Drupal 10 fully supports responsive popups.

4. How to Create a Popup in Drupal 11

Drupal 11 is the latest version with improved headless capabilities and faster page load times. For popups:

  • Install Poper for Drupal 11.

  • Utilize advanced caching to prevent unnecessary popup loading.

  • Use headless API support for React-based popups if needed.


Best Practices for High-Converting Popups in Drupal

Best Practices for High-Converting Popups in Drupal

Simply adding popups isn’t enough—here are some best practices:

  • Exit-Intent Popups: Show when a user is about to leave.

  • Time-Based Popups: Trigger after 10-20 seconds.

  • Scroll-Based Popups: Show after the user scrolls 50% of the page.

  • Targeting & Personalization: Display popups based on location or behavior.

Modern Button Try Poper Today

Common Popup Mistakes to Avoid

Common Popup Mistakes to Avoid

To ensure high engagement, avoid:
🚫 Too Many Popups: Overloading users leads to frustration.
🚫 No Close Button: Always provide a way to dismiss popups.
🚫 Slow Loading: Ensure popups don’t slow down your page.
🚫 Not Mobile-Friendly: Popups should be responsive.

Why Use Poper for Popups in Drupal?

Why Use Poper for Popups in Drupal

Poper is the best solution for Drupal popups because:
No Coding Required
Pre-Built Templates for Lead Generation, Sales, and Announcements
Advanced Targeting & Triggers
Integrates with Marketing Tools

🚀 Ready to boost engagement? Sign up for Poper today and start creating powerful, high-converting popups in minutes!

Modern Button Try Poper Today

FAQs

  • How can I create a popup in Drupal without coding?

    You can create a popup in Drupal without coding by using Poper or other popup modules like Colorbox or Popup API. These tools provide an intuitive interface to design and manage popups without requiring manual coding.

  • Does Drupal have a built-in popup feature?

    No, Drupal does not have a built-in popup feature. However, you can add popups using modules like Poper, Colorbox, and Popup module, or by embedding custom JavaScript and CSS for more advanced popup designs.

  • How do I trigger a popup on page load in Drupal?

    To trigger a popup on page load in Drupal, you can configure your popup module settings or use custom JavaScript with setTimeout() or window.onload to display the popup after a delay. Poper allows you to set display rules easily within its dashboard.

  • Can I show popups on specific pages in Drupal?

    Yes, you can show popups on specific pages in Drupal by setting display conditions within the Poper module or other popup plugins. Most modules allow you to target URLs, user roles, or actions like button clicks.

  • What is the best popup module for Drupal?

    The best popup module for Drupal depends on your needs, but Poper is an excellent choice for a code-free, AI-powered popup builder. Other popular options include Colorbox, Popup API, and Magnific Popup for those comfortable with some coding.

© 2024 Poper (Latracal). All rights reserved.

Grigora Made with Grigora